#b363b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b363b5 is composed of 70.2% red, 38.8%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.1%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 298.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 54.9%. #b363b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#67006b.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#b363b5 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#b363b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b363b5 has RGB values of R:179, G:99,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11756469.

Shades and Tints of #b363b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#faf5fa is the lightest one.
